Ticket QP-412: Query planner regression in the Larkfield staging cluster. After last week's deploy, the planner on staging picks sequential scans because the stats collector credentials are wrong, so ANALYZE silently fails. Fix is to point the planner sidecar at the correct stats endpoint. Add the following line to staging.env before redeploying.

vault entry, yahif-yajep: COURIER_KEY29=b802bdf8034096b65a51c6ba5abe2

Handover — turnstile upgrade, Ordway Plaza lobby

The Fenwright techs finished fitting the new readers on turnstiles 1–3 today; turnstile 4 is still on the old firmware and will be swapped Thursday. Until then it rejects reissued badges, so send anyone affected to gate 2. Spare lanyards are in the bottom drawer. The contractor crew returns at 07:30 and will need escorting through the service corridor. For their escort access, use the temporary pass listed below.

turnstile pass: bdg-FVNQRS-72965873

This PR reworks job scheduling on the Renderhollow transcoding farm. Previously, worker nodes pulled jobs greedily, which caused long 4K jobs to starve short clips during evening peaks. The new scheduler buckets jobs by estimated duration and enforces per-bucket concurrency caps. As a contractor onboarding to this codebase, note that you should never hardcode these caps in worker configs — they are read from the shared tuning module at startup and hot-reloaded on change. The current production values are given below.

limits module of tafop-hahop:
WEIGHTS = {
    "julmir": 223,
    "belox": 987,
    "lamion": 470,
    "pelath": 609,
    "fraok": 1010,
    "eliion": 343,
    "drudor": 342,
}

Handover for the weekly eng sync: I'm transferring ownership of Duskrunner, our nightly backfill scheduler, to Priya. Current state: all jobs healthy except the ledger-reconciliation backfill, which retries once nightly due to a slow upstream from the Kestwick warehouse. Retry logic, window sizing, and concurrency caps were all tuned carefully last quarter — please don't change them without a load test. For full transparency at the sync, the production instance runs with these configuration values.

settings of hawep-kadug:
RALAEL_HOST=ralael.tolvaqlabs.internal
RALAEL_PORT=9000